The lyrics of "Rap God" by Eminem convey a powerful message about Eminem's confidence and skill as a rapper. Throughout the song, Eminem asserts his dominance in the rap game, comparing himself to a rap god and showcasing his lyrical dexterity and prowess.
He talks about his upbringing and influences, referencing other artists like Rakim, 2Pac, and NWA. Eminem also addresses criticism and controversy surrounding his music, highlighting his ability to push boundaries and provoke reactions.
The lyrics touch on themes of self-expression, creativity, and resilience. Eminem embraces his role as an influential artist, challenging societal norms and expectations. He addresses personal struggles and past mistakes while maintaining a defiant and unapologetic attitude.
Overall, "Rap God" is a declaration of Eminem's talent and impact on the music industry, showcasing his fearless and unapologetic approach to his art. The song serves as a reminder of Eminem's legacy and lasting influence in the world of hip-hop.
